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
423127126 561 534 1326920 587
43452730427 6150461 234332
43452730427 6150461 234332
1022 02414 109988840 5113511 145
All about undefined
Interested in learning more?
43452730427 6150461 234332
1022 02414 109988840 5113511 145
See more
96078 195458364 9249821
53713 185845249 916583
See more
25 663515 538564122
7902099391 1307 3011648
See more